Sorry about the confusion. I have seen these on various sites in connection 
with the Seeing AI app. I am considering buying a pair, but can’t find them in 
the UK, as yet and was wondering if other people had already tried them. they 
look pretty good and, with the potentiality of working with apps, may be a 
great boon to us. Plus, as the alternative, at the moment, other devices such 
as Orcam, they are a fraction of the price. I believe, they have been on sale 
for at least a year now. The producers, pivot head,   are working with 
Microsoft on their compatibility with seeing AI app. The developer of the 
Seeing AI app, a VIP himself, uses them with the app. so, where to go from here?

> The link takes you to the website for a pair of glasses called “Smart”. 
> Apparently they can be used in connection with the Seeing AI app or at least 
> I think that is how this thread started.
> On said website is a link for “Buy Smart”, if you click on that it takes you 
> to another site where it says they are $379.99 (I assume that is US Dollars) 
> and the following product description:
